Flower-type ZnO nanorods were synthesized by two-step low temperature solution growth and dye-sensitized with phenosafranine for the first time. The scanning electron microscope result shows that the diameter and the length of a single rod of the flower-type nanostructures depend on the method of synthesis. Optical absorption analysis shows a visible absorption at 517 nm, which was otherwise absent in nano ZnO . The photoluminescence spectra of ZnO and dye-sensitized ZnO nano flowers were also analyzed.
